1987 Porsche 930 Turbo 3.3 Coupé for sale!

This beautiful free 930 was finished at the Zuffenhausen factory in 1987 and delivered to its first owner in Italy. The car is finished in classic Silver metallic over black and outfitted some nice extras.

The current owner acquired the car in 2016 with 43,000 kilometers from a Belgian classic car dealer. Since acquisition, an additional 7.000 kilometers are now showing. The Belgian dealer was in Italy looking for another car when he saw this Turbo receiving a full recommissioning at an Italian Porsche dealership. Being impressed by the overal condition of the car, he made an offer. He learned that the car belonged to an Italian who owned the car for a long time and at one point decided to store the car. In 2015 after 10 years of being stored; the owner’s son decided to have the car brought back to use by the Porsche dealer. The dealer where the Belgian dealer saw the car.

THE 930 TURBO

Much of the Porsche 911’s development had resulted from the factory’s racing programme, which spurred the development of ‚Project 930‘: the legendary 911 Turbo. In production from April 1975, the Turbo married a KKK turbocharger to the 3.0-litre Carrera RSR engine, in road trim a combination that delivered 260bhp for a top speed of 155mph. But the Turbo wasn’t just about top speed, it was also the best-equipped 911 and amazingly flexible – hence only four speeds in the gearbox – being capable of racing from a standstill to 100mph (161km/h) in 14 seconds.

What set the 911 Turbo apart from its peers was the relaxed way this performance was delivered. Comparing the Turbo to similarly quick ‚he-man‘ cars such as the Holman & Moody-tuned Cobra 427 and the Ford GT40, Motor’s Roger Bell reckoned what made the Porsche so different was that it „hurls you forward with similar velocity but in an uncannily quiet and effortless way. To be shoved so hard in the back that you need high-back seats to keep your head on, yet neither to feel nor hear anything more than a muffled hum, is a very odd sensation indeed in a car“.

The Turbo’s characteristic flared wheel arches and ‚tea tray‘ rear spoiler had already been seen on the Carrera model, while the interior was the most luxurious yet seen in a 911, featuring leather upholstery, air conditioning and electric windows. For 1978 the Turbo’s engine was enlarged to 3.3 litres, gaining an inter-cooler in the process; power increased to 300bhp and the top speed of what was the fastest-accelerating road car of its day went up to 257km/h. The Porsche 911 Turbo sold in the thousands, becoming the definitive sports car of its age.
